Is shortwave radio the same as ham radio?

If you’re wondering “Is shortwave radio the same as ham radio,” the answer is no. Shortwave radios broadcast on stations in the shortwave range of the spectrum. These are specific broadcasting stations. Ham radios, on the other hand, are two-way communication systems where multiple people can connect with each other.

What are the components of a shortwave radio transceiver?

The following are components of a shortwave radio transceiver. ● Radio Frequency (RF) Section: This is the most crucial part of the transceiver, where the radio signals are generated, amplified, and transmitted. The RF section includes the oscillator, amplifier, mixer, and modulator circuits.
